Professor Susan Millns serves as Dean of the Graduate College at Canterbury Christ Church University, actively supervising postgraduate research across legal, criminological, and social justice domains.
Her research expertise encompasses:
- Public and international law frameworks
- Police conduct oversight and vulnerability responses
- Migration policy analysis (EU border dynamics, migrant protections)
- Child protection systems and multi-agency decision-making
- Social inequality studies (including autism rights and nomadic communities)
Professor Millns mentors students on high-impact projects addressing real-world legal gaps—from Tanzania's investment treaties to UK autism inequality timelines—demonstrating commitment to socially engaged scholarship. Her supervisory portfolio reflects interdisciplinary rigor at the law-society interface, particularly in human rights and institutional accountability contexts.
